Setting up Key Marketing Objectives
1. Define Your Vision and Mission
- Clarify the long-term vision for the sugar production business, emphasizing sustainability, quality, and community impact.
- Ensure the mission statement aligns with overall business goals and resonates with target audiences.
2. Conduct Market Research
- Analyze industry trends, consumer preferences, and competitive landscape.
- Identify target market segments, including demographics, purchasing behaviors, and regional demand for sugar products.
3. Set SMART Objectives
- Specific: Clearly define what you want to achieve (e.g., increase market share or launch a new product line).
- Measurable: Establish quantifiable metrics (e.g., increase sales by 20% within a year).
- Achievable: Ensure objectives are realistic and attainable given resources and market conditions.
- Relevant: Align objectives with broader business goals and industry trends.
- Time-bound: Set deadlines for achieving each objective to maintain focus and accountability.
4. Identify Key Performance Indicators (KPIs)
- Determine which metrics will track progress towards each objective (e.g., sales revenue, customer acquisition cost, or market share percentage).
- Regularly review KPIs to assess performance and adapt strategies as needed.
5. Analyze SWOT
- Conduct a SWOT analysis to identify strengths, weaknesses, opportunities, and threats related to the sugar production business.
- Use insights from the SWOT analysis to inform your marketing objectives and strategies.
6. Segment Your Audience
- Break down your target market into specific segments (e.g., retail consumers, food manufacturers, or export markets).
- Tailor marketing objectives to address the unique needs and preferences of each segment.
7. Develop Value Propositions
- Articulate clear value propositions that differentiate your sugar products from competitors.
- Ensure marketing objectives reflect the unique benefits your products offer, such as organic certification or local sourcing.
8. Set Budget Constraints
- Define a budget for marketing activities and ensure objectives are financially feasible.
- Allocate resources effectively to maximize ROI on marketing efforts.
9. Incorporate Digital Marketing Goals
- Set objectives for digital marketing channels, such as social media engagement, website traffic, and online sales conversions.
- Consider incorporating SEO strategies to enhance online visibility and drive organic traffic.
10. Plan for Evaluation and Adjustment
- Outline a process for regularly reviewing and adjusting marketing objectives based on performance data and market changes.
- Establish a timeline for quarterly or bi-annual reviews to ensure objectives remain relevant and achievable. By following these steps, you can create a solid foundation for your sugar production business’s marketing objectives, aligning them with overall business goals and ensuring they are responsive to market dynamics.

Digital Marketing Strategies for Sugar Production businesses
1. Search Engine Optimization (SEO):
- Keyword Research: Identify relevant keywords that potential customers might use to find sugar products. Focus on long-tail keywords like “organic sugar suppliers” or “bulk sugar for baking” to attract specific audiences.
- On-Page SEO: Optimize product pages, blog content, and landing pages by incorporating target keywords in titles, meta descriptions, headers, and throughout the content. Ensure that images have alt tags that include keywords.
- Content Marketing: Create valuable content that answers common questions about sugar production, health benefits, recipes, and industry trends. Regular blog posts can improve organic search rankings and position the business as a thought leader.
- Local SEO: If the business has a physical location, optimize for local search by claiming and updating the Google My Business listing. Encourage customer reviews and ensure that local keywords are integrated into the site.
2. Social Media Marketing:
- Platform Selection: Choose the appropriate social media platforms such as Instagram, Facebook, and LinkedIn, where the target audience is most active. Instagram is great for visual content like recipes or production photos, while LinkedIn can be used for B2B connections.
- Content Creation: Share engaging content that showcases the production process, sustainability practices, and the versatility of sugar in cooking and baking. Use high-quality images and videos to attract attention.
- User Engagement: Interact with followers by responding to comments, hosting Q&A sessions, and encouraging user-generated content. Create polls and contests to enhance engagement and build a community around the brand.
- Influencer Collaborations: Partner with food bloggers, chefs, and influencers to reach a broader audience. They can create recipes featuring your sugar products, providing authentic promotion.
3. Pay-Per-Click (PPC) Advertising:
- Google Ads: Create targeted Google Ads campaigns to reach potential customers actively searching for sugar products. Utilize retargeting strategies to keep the brand top-of-mind for visitors who didn’t convert initially.
- Social Media Ads: Leverage Facebook and Instagram ads to promote special offers, new products, or seasonal recipes. Use demographic targeting to ensure ads reach the appropriate audience based on age, location, and interests.
- Display Advertising: Use display ads on relevant websites and blogs that cater to food, health, and cooking topics. This can help increase brand awareness among potential customers who may not be actively searching for sugar products.
- Analytics and Optimization: Regularly track the performance of PPC campaigns using analytics tools. Analyze click-through rates, conversion rates, and ROI to optimize ad spend and improve targeting strategies. By integrating these digital marketing strategies into the marketing plan, a sugar production business can effectively enhance its online presence, attract new customers, and drive sales growth.
Offline Marketing Strategies for Sugar Production businesses
1. Public Relations Initiatives: Develop relationships with local media outlets to feature stories about your sugar production process, sustainability efforts, and community contributions. Create press releases for significant milestones, such as new product launches or partnerships.
2. Community Events: Host or participate in local fairs, farmer’s markets, and agricultural expos. Set up booths to showcase your sugar products, offer samples, and engage with potential customers. Consider sponsoring local events to increase brand visibility.
3. Workshops and Educational Seminars: Organize workshops that educate the community about sugar production, its benefits, and various uses. Invite local chefs to demonstrate recipes using your sugar products, fostering a connection with the audience.
4. Print Advertising: Invest in advertisements in local newspapers, magazines, and agricultural publications. Highlight your unique selling points, such as organic production methods or local sourcing, to attract your target market.
5. Direct Mail Campaigns: Create attractive brochures or flyers detailing your sugar products, recipes, and special promotions. Send them to households, restaurants, and businesses in your area to raise awareness and encourage trial.
6. Collaboration with Local Businesses: Partner with local bakeries, cafes, and restaurants to feature your sugar in their menu items. Consider co-marketing opportunities, such as joint promotions or events, to reach a wider audience.
7. Sponsorships: Sponsor local sports teams, schools, or community organizations. This not only builds goodwill but also enhances brand recognition in the community.
8. Sampling Programs: Set up tasting events in grocery stores or local markets. Allow consumers to sample your sugar products to encourage purchases and gather feedback.
9. Educational Brochures: Create informative brochures that discuss the benefits of your sugar, production methods, and sustainability practices. Distribute them at local events, stores, and community centers.
10. In-store Promotions: Collaborate with retailers for in-store displays or special promotions. Offer discounts or bundle deals to incentivize purchases and increase visibility. By integrating these offline marketing strategies into your overall marketing plan, your sugar production business can effectively reach and engage your target audience while building a strong local presence.

1. What is a marketing plan for a sugar production business? A marketing plan for a sugar production business outlines strategies and actions to promote your products, attract customers, and increase sales. It typically includes market analysis, target audience identification, marketing goals, and specific tactics to reach those goals.
2. Why is a marketing plan important for my sugar production business? A marketing plan is crucial as it helps you define your business objectives, understand your competition, and identify your target market. It provides direction and helps allocate resources effectively, ensuring that your marketing efforts are aligned with your business goals.
3. Who is my target audience in the sugar production industry? Your target audience may include wholesalers, retailers, food manufacturers, and consumers. Specific segments could be those looking for organic or specialty sugar products, health-conscious buyers, or businesses in the food and beverage industry that require bulk purchases.
4. What are some effective marketing strategies for a sugar production business? Effective marketing strategies can include:
- Content marketing: Create informative blogs and articles about sugar production, uses, and health benefits.
- Social media marketing: Use platforms like Instagram and Facebook to showcase your products and engage with consumers.
- SEO: Optimize your website for relevant keywords to improve visibility in search engine results.
- Email marketing: Send newsletters with updates, promotions, and educational content to keep your audience engaged.
- Trade shows and events: Attend industry exhibitions to network and showcase your products.
5. How can I determine the pricing strategy for my sugar products? To determine your pricing strategy, consider factors such as production costs, competitor pricing, market demand, and your target audience’s willingness to pay. Conduct a thorough market analysis to ensure your prices are competitive yet profitable.
6. What role does branding play in my sugar production marketing plan? Branding is essential as it helps differentiate your products from competitors. A strong brand identity can create customer loyalty, improve recognition, and convey the quality and values of your sugar production business. Consistent branding across all marketing channels is key to building trust and credibility.
7. How can I measure the success of my marketing plan? You can measure the success of your marketing plan through various metrics, including:
- Sales growth and revenue
- Website traffic and SEO rankings
- Engagement rates on social media platforms
- Email open and click-through rates
- Customer feedback and satisfaction levels
8. What are common challenges faced when marketing a sugar production business? Common challenges include intense competition, changing consumer preferences towards healthier options, regulatory compliance, and market fluctuations. Staying informed about industry trends and adapting your strategies accordingly can help address these challenges.
9. How often should I update my marketing plan? It’s recommended to review and update your marketing plan at least annually. However, if you experience significant changes in the market, consumer behavior, or your business goals, you may need to make adjustments more frequently.
